Transaction 7830143e762b643f95b5b0b7255b6b017f6d0290156c94f940916e2a585f2187

18 Input
2 Outputs
  • 7830143e762b643f95b5b0b7255b6b017f6d0290156c94f940916e2a585f2187:0
  • value  8000000
    address  3Kpix2t71XgYy4UjjNon1YsTcgfiQqjndd
  • 7830143e762b643f95b5b0b7255b6b017f6d0290156c94f940916e2a585f2187:1
  • value  1697941
    address  16v97cmLuVREtyV4EcjocL4uWGk5sghLsy